In Glenn, Michigan, where the serene landscape meets the tight-knit community, mental health is a pivotal aspect of overall well-being. Virtual Intensive Outpatient Programs (IOPs) offer a critical lifeline for residents grappling with mental health and substance use disorders. These online treatment options remove barriers to care, allowing individuals to engage in therapy from the comfort of their homes while staying connected to their community.

For the residents of Glenn, the benefits of Virtual IOP are significant. With sessions typically structured to accommodate 9-20 hours per week, individuals can balance their mental health needs with work, school, and family commitments. This flexibility is essential for those who may not have the time or resources to attend traditional in-person therapy. Residents can expect evidence-based treatments, including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) and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T), tailored to their specific challenges.

Getting started with a Virtual IOP in Glenn is straightforward. Programs offer various options for adults and some for adolescents, featuring individual, group, and family therapy sessions led by licensed therapists. Utilizing HIPAA-compliant video conferencing, these services ensure privacy and security. Most major insurance plans, including Medicare and Medicaid, are accepted. Embark Behavioral Health Virtual IOP

Mental Health & Substance UseVerified
Available in 17 States
Preteens, adolescents, teens, and young adults (generally ages 12-34)
(443) 390-5670

Intensive group and individual therapy tailored to youth; utilizes evidence-based modalities like CBT, DBT, and Exposure Response Prevention specifically for this age group. Family involvement is emphasized to support teens/young adults. Offers an OCD-specific virtual track through partnership with IOCDF. Operates in a wide range of states with virtual care to increase access.

Eating Recovery At Home (ERC Virtual IOP)

Mental Health
Available in 16 States
Children, adolescents, and adults (inclusive of LGBTQ+)
877-825-8584

3x 3-hour groups weekly plus individual, nutrition & family therapy; outcomes equal to in-person; widely insurance-covered; named a top online program 2022-2024.
